Vacancy: Senior Care Assistant (Days) – AV1715

Hours: The shifts are 7am - 2pm, 1:30pm-20:30pm or 2pm-21pm. Occasionally long days 7am - 20:15 pm. There is a rolling rota, so staff know their shifts in advance.

Location: Bishop’s Stortford

Pay rate: c£33,000pa

A Senior Care Assistant is required at our Client’s fantastic purpose built Residential Care facility situated in Bishop’s Stortford. The home offers the highest standards of care where dignity is respected, interests are nurtured and residents are cared for like family.

As aSenior Care Assistant, you’ll lead by example and support the team in delivering exceptional care. Your duties will include:

  • Assisting residents with personal care and daily living activities.
  • Administering medication (after training)
  • Supporting care staff and overseeing shifts
  • Liaising with families, GPs, and other professionals
  • Dealing with emergencies
  • Keeping clear and accurate records

What We’re Looking For:

  • NVQ Level 2 or 3 in Health & Social Care (or working towards it)
  • Previous experience in a care home setting
  • A kind, patient and reliable personality
  • Ability to lead a small team with confidence and warmth
  • Good communication skills and a genuine love for elderly care
  • Due to our rural setting, a car driver or the ability to get to work without relying on public transport is essential
